With the development of industry, atmospheric SO2is rapidly increased, seriously affecting plant growth and crop production. However, the mechanism of how plants respond to high SO2-induced sulfite stress is poorly characterized. Here we report that ABA signaling is involved in plant tolerance to sulfite stress. Our results indicate that the sulfite-stressed plants accumulated higher ABA with promoted expression of ABA-responsive genes compared with unstressed control and the ABA-biosynthetic mutantABA DEFICIENT2(aba2–1) had less sulfite tolerance than wild-type plants, supporting a role of ABA in plant sulfite stress response. ABA functions through its downstream transcription factor ABF4 because theabf4–1mutant was more sensitive but the35 S::ABF4plants more tolerant to the sulfite stress than wild-type plants. Further, ABF4 upregulates SOX expression by directly binding to its promoter and overexpression ofSOXcan rescue increased stress sensitivity ofabf4–1mutant, showing thatSOXacts downstream ofABF4. Together, our study reveals that the sulfite-stressed plants can activate ABA/ABF4 signaling to enhanceSOXexpression in plant sulfite stress tolerance.
